You are doing interview research and you ask the following question: "So, tell me about your experiences during your first year
vovikov84 [41]

Answer:

The kind of question asked is open ended question.

Explanation:

An open-ended question is a type of question whose answer cannot be either a "yes" or "no".

It is a question with a detailed answer which would include the feelings or knowledge of the one who is answering. It is possible that the questioner compares the response of the open-ended question with the information he knows. The given question asking the experiences during the first year in college will be a detailed answer given. So, it is an open-ended question.

This new Power Principle is the message emerging from my previous work on the causes of war1 and this book on genocide and government mass murder--what I call democide--in this century. The more power a government has, the more it can act arbitrarily according to the whims and desires of the elite, the more it will make war on others and murder its foreign and domestic subjects. The more constrained the power of governments, the more it is diffused, checked and balanced, the less it will aggress on others and commit democide. At the extremes of Power2, totalitarian communist governments slaughter their people by the tens of millions, while many democracies can barely bring themselves to execute even serial murderers.
